Surgical treatment of Metarhizium anisopliae sclerokeratitis and endophthalmitis

open access: yesIndian Journal of Ophthalmology, 2017
A 55-year-old nurse was referred with a 5-month history of right eye corneal abscess. The initial injury occurred when doing lawn work. The infection worsened despite multiple antibiotic, antiviral, and steroid treatments. Visual acuity was limited to hand motion.

Metarhizium mendonceae sp. nov.: An important biological control agent for insect pests.

open access: yesPLoS ONE
The Metarhizium anisopliae complex consists of 34 formally described phylogenetic species. Metarhizium anisopliae sensu lato has been used for decades in Brazil as a biological control agent for controlling spittlebugs in sugarcane plantations.
